How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 18,717 against 16,732 in Bhutan, a difference of 1,985.
That makes Kyrgyzstan's figure about 1.1 times Bhutan's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2015 it was Kyrgyzstan ahead.
Bhutan ranks 81st and Kyrgyzstan ranks 79th of 98 countries.
Kyrgyzstan has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
